Illustrator: Alien Design
In Digital Class with Simon we learnt how to use the pen tool on illustrator and how to do gradient shading and multiples for shadow, work with the layers and fill colour and make Outlines different widths the idea of making a character based on stereotypes I chose the nerd/geek stereotype and used a person to base this on. We also learnt how to make multiple versions of the character and how to lay it out for quick styles or colour schemes.
